Asia Open Access 2019: A platform for open data

Asia Open Access Dhaka 2019, was held in Dhaka, Bangladesh on March 6-7, hosted by Bangladesh Agricultural Research Council (BARC) in association with Confederation of Open Access Repositories (COAR). In the conference, six technical sessions and one concluding and recommendation session were included. Malawi must harness the innovative minds of its youth for a climate smart future: Blessings Likagwa

Blessings Likagwa has a passion for farming. The 29-year-old farmer from Kasungu, Malawi was recently recognized by the 2019 MAIZE Youth Innovators Awards – Africa for his work using data from drones to implement climate smart improvements on his maize farm, and inspiring other local farmers to do the same. Promoting inclusive Agri-preneurship Development for Youth in Africa

It is no news that Africa has one of the largest growing populations and from this expansion, Sub-Saharan Africa’s labour force is also expanding at a rate of 3 percent per year with an additional 375 million young people expected to reach working age by 2035. Fate of sunflower production in Pakistan

Sunflower (Helianthus annuus L.) is an important crop which is cultivated around the world for food and oil purposes.  The seeds of sunflower are either consumed directly or they are extracted for the oil which is used for cooking and other purposes.
